J. P. Moreland: The Role of Philosophy and Neuroscience in Shaping Theological Anthropology

Video Icon

Dr. J. P. Moreland was recently visited Southeastern Seminary, and in this PhD lecture, he discusses the role of philosophy and neuroscience in shaping theological anthropology.

Dr. Moreland is Distinguished Professor of philosophy at Talbot School of Theology, Biola University. He received a B. S. in physical chemistry from the University of Missouri, a Th.M. in theology from Dallas Theological Seminary, an M.A. in philosophy from the University of California at Riverside, and a Ph.D. in philosophy at the University of Southern California.
